BAG Working Groups work with the BAG Secretariat to plan and implement course of action within a specific area of BAG activities. They are focused on meeting one of more of the overall BAG strategic objectives and delivering against those (objectives explicitly set by the BAG Board) and work under terms of reference and delegated authority as agreed by the BAG Board.
BAG Working Groups are open to the wider BAG membership to provide for active and diverse involvement. Each BAG member company is entitled to put forward a representative for each of the Working Groups.
